be-scínan
To shine upon, illuminate ⬩ collustrare, illuminare
Entry preview:
To shine upon, illuminate; collustrare, illuminare, Mec heaðosigel bescíneþ the glorious sun shines upon me, Exon. 126 b; Th. 486, 18; Rä. 72, 17
be-sceran
To shear off, to shave, cut off ⬩ attondere, amputare, præcidere
Entry preview:
To shear off, to shave, cut off; attondere, amputare, præcidere Hý eall heora heáfod besceáron they all shaved their heads, Ors. 4, 11; Bos. 96, 37; capitibus rasis, Ors. Hav. 4, 20; p. 270, 5. Ðæt he to preóste bescoren beón mihte that he might be shorn
be-scerian
To deprive, separate, defraud ⬩ privare, separare, fraudare
Entry preview:
To deprive, separate, defraud; privare, separare, fraudare wærþ Ceolwulf his ríces bescered here Ceolwulf was deprived of his kingdom, Hér, A. D. 821, Chr. 821.; Erl. 63, 10. Ðonne ic bescired beó fram túnscíre when I am deprived of my stewardship, Lk
